11. Choose Tall, Slender Plants for Narrow Spaces

Credit: @thetravellingapartment / Instagram
Your tiny balcony can still accommodate beautiful plants when you choose tall, narrow varieties that won’t overwhelm your limited space.
Try combining geraniums, African milk trees, small cacti, and compact citrus trees for diverse textures and heights. This vertical approach maximizes your greenery without sacrificing precious floor space for your essential seating and table areas.
12. Invest in Large Statement Container Plants

Credit: @thepsychgarden / Instagram
You’ll get incredible impact from low-maintenance plants like Quickfire hydrangeas that bloom for months with minimal care.
Pair these flowering showstoppers with lush ferns that stay beautiful from spring through fall. This combination gives you both spectacular blooms and reliable greenery that keeps your patio looking professionally designed throughout the growing season.

21. Enjoy Spring Bulbs in Portable Containers

Credit: @thepsychgarden / Instagram
You don’t need massive flower beds to enjoy spectacular spring tulip displays on your patio.
Large containers with excellent drainage work perfectly for these gorgeous bulbs during cold seasons. This portable approach lets you create stunning spring color exactly where you want it while giving you flexibility to rearrange your display as other plants come into bloom.
